17735
Aug 23, 2006, updated at 14:01:45 (UTC)
9113
1
0
Mit PHP Dateien und Ordner zippen
Hallo Leute,
folgendes Problem: Auf meinem Webserver liegt meine Homepage, die in PHP geschrieben ist. Dies sind natürlich mehrere Dateien und Ordner. Ich möchte nun, dass wenn man eine PHP-Datei in dem Homepage-Verzeichnis aufruft, das komplette Verzeichnis, also alle Dateien inklusive Unterordner in das ZIP-Format verpackt werden und an den Browser gesendet wird.
Wie ist das realisierbar?
Gruß,
Ahnenforscher
PS: Der Befehl exec ist aus sicherheitsgründen auf dem Webserver deaktiviert
folgendes Problem: Auf meinem Webserver liegt meine Homepage, die in PHP geschrieben ist. Dies sind natürlich mehrere Dateien und Ordner. Ich möchte nun, dass wenn man eine PHP-Datei in dem Homepage-Verzeichnis aufruft, das komplette Verzeichnis, also alle Dateien inklusive Unterordner in das ZIP-Format verpackt werden und an den Browser gesendet wird.
Wie ist das realisierbar?
Gruß,
Ahnenforscher
PS: Der Befehl exec ist aus sicherheitsgründen auf dem Webserver deaktiviert
Please also mark the comments that contributed to the solution of the article
Content-Key: 38615
Url: https://administrator.de/contentid/38615
Printed on: April 25, 2024 at 11:04 o'clock
1 Comment
Du benötigst erstmal diese Zip-Klasse http://www.phpclasses.org/browse/file/3631.html
mit new zipfile("Containername.zip") erstellst du einen neuen Container, mit der Methode AddFile("Pfad") fügst du eine Datei in deinen Container ein.
Den Rest weiß ich leider nicht mehr ... habe nur einmal kurz damit gearbeitet, hoffe ich konnte dir trotzdem helfen.
mit new zipfile("Containername.zip") erstellst du einen neuen Container, mit der Methode AddFile("Pfad") fügst du eine Datei in deinen Container ein.
Den Rest weiß ich leider nicht mehr ... habe nur einmal kurz damit gearbeitet, hoffe ich konnte dir trotzdem helfen.